Storms Headed Our Way, Five Days Of Rain in the Forecast

Get out your umbrella as a series of storms is expected to hit the Bay Area

Enjoy the sunshine while it lasts.

A series of storms is expected to hit the Bay Area this week.

Rain is forecasted to start early Wednesday with at least showers every day through Sunday.

Breezy conditions are also expected on Wednesday, Friday and Saturday night.

High temperatures are expected to reach only the high 50s.

The storms might also dampen some of the holiday activities planned around Pleasant Hill.

Among them is the annual Light Up The Night Tree Lighting, which is scheduled for 5 p.m. Wednesday in downtown Pleasant Hill.

The storms might also make holiday shopping a little more challenging.
